Senior Software Engineer - .NET (Depositary Services)

Overview

US Bank is expanding its technology capabilities supporting the Depositary Services function across Europe. We are seeking a Senior Software Engineer to play a key role in the design, development, and evolution of enterprise-grade financial systems used by teams in Ireland and Luxembourg. This role is part of the European technology team and requires close collaboration with business stakeholders, data providers, and cross-functional engineering teams. The successful candidate will bring strong expertise in the .NET ecosystem, along with a proven track record of delivering scalable, high-quality solutions in complex environments. As a senior engineer, you will own key components of the platform, contribute to architectural decisions, and help raise engineering standards across the team. You will work across a full-stack environment, with a primary focus on building scalable backend services and supporting frontend integration.

Key Responsibilities
  • Own the design and architecture of core components within the depositary platform, ensuring alignment with enterprise standards and long-term system evolution
  • Design, develop, and enhance scalable backend services using the .NET stack, supporting complex financial data workflows and regulatory processes
  • Collaborate with business stakeholders to elicit, analyse, and translate business requirements into robust technical solutions
  • Lead technical design discussions, providing guidance on best practices, trade-offs, and system architecture
  • Plan and deliver system upgrades and enhancements, ensuring high quality, reliability, and alignment with business priorities
  • Ensure production stability, including incident ownership, troubleshooting, root cause analysis, and continuous improvement of system reliability
  • Design and manage integrations with internal and external data providers, including ETL processes and data pipelines
  • Drive automation and efficiency improvements across the development lifecycle, including build, deployment, and monitoring processes
  • Contribute to technical strategy and roadmap, identifying opportunities to improve scalability, performance, and maintainability
  • Mentor and support other engineers, contributing to code reviews, knowledge sharing, and engineering best practices
  • Support and enhance operational systems, including Depositary dashboards and compliance monitoring systems (e.g., rule configuration and data exception management)


Basic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or equivalent practical experience
  • 5+ years of professional software engineering experience, with strong focus on the .NET ecosystem (C#, ASP.NET, .NET Core)
  • Proven track record of delivering scalable, high-quality software solutions in production environments
  • Strong experience in system design and architecture, particularly in distributed or service-based systems
  • Solid understanding of relational databases, data modelling, and performance optimisation
  • Experience working with data pipelines, ETL processes, and multi-source data integration


Preferred Skills / Experience
  • Experience within financial services, particularly Depositary Services or similar regulated domains
  • Familiarity with large-scale data systems, including regulatory reporting or reconciliation workflows
  • Strong problem-solving, analytical, and organisational skills
  •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to explain technical concepts to non-technical stakeholders
  • Experience working in Agile environments and collaborating across distributed teams


Technical Skills
  • Advanced experience with C#, .NET Core, ASP.NET, and Web API development
  • Strong experience designing and building RESTful APIs and service-oriented architectures
  • Solid expertise in SQL Server (or equivalent), including database design and query optimisation
  • Experience building and supporting ETL pipelines and complex data integrations
  • Hands-on experience with CI/CD pipelines, automated testing, and modern DevOps practices
  • Familiarity with frontend integration technologies (e.g., Telerik Kendo UI or similar frameworks)
  • Experience with version control systems such as Git
